ELIZABETH Tucker 1620 – 1670 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1620

Birth Location: England, Hertfordshire, England

Death Date: 7 Jul 1670

Death Location: Hartford, Hartford, Connecticut, United States

Father: RICHARD II

Mother: Agnes Wyatt

Spouse(s): John Pratt

Children(s): John Pratt

ELIZABETH Tucker was born in 1620 in England, Hertfordshire, England, the child of RICHARD Tucker II and Agnes Wyatt. ELIZABETH Tucker married John Pratt, and had children including John Pratt. ELIZABETH Tucker passed away in 1670 in Hartford, Hartford, Connecticut, United States.
